[Hybrid reconstructive interventions in distal aortic dissection]
Summary
Prosthetic repair of descending thoracic aorta dissection is best when blood flow targets the true lumen. Stenting to expand the true channel improves hemodynamic outcomes in patients with aortic dissection.

Background:
- Distal aortic dissection requires effective treatment strategies.
- Prosthetic repair of the descending thoracic aorta is a common intervention.
- Understanding optimal blood flow management is crucial for successful outcomes.
Observation:
- A prospective study evaluated 26 patients with distal aortic dissection treated with prosthetic repair.
- Patients were divided into two groups based on blood flow direction: true lumen (Group One) vs. both lumens (Group Two).
- Outcomes were assessed regarding false channel thrombosis, aortic dilatation, and need for further interventions.
Findings:
- Group One (true lumen flow) showed 80% false channel thrombosis and true channel enlargement.
- Group Two (both lumens flow) had a 45% rate of remote abdominal aortic dilatation, requiring re-intervention in three patients.
- Two patients received stentgrafts for visceral branch perfusion during surgery.
Implications:
- Directing blood flow into the true lumen during prosthetic repair is associated with better outcomes.
- Stenting to expand the true aortic channel distal to repair site enhances hemodynamic results.
- These findings suggest optimizing flow dynamics is key for managing descending thoracic aorta dissection.
